Output 41e598031971f51213a63aa7dd168e133d483da95ba983dcc7db0da03215d13f:0

value
2547245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944d70672e08e5ae3344d469db208838ab5d8045 OP_EQUAL
address
3FDAhViNP1fAYbF92NNtEE2pCKEMFizCv5
transaction
41e598031971f51213a63aa7dd168e133d483da95ba983dcc7db0da03215d13f
spent
true